How-To:
  • Apply Too Faced Shadow Insurance eyshadow primer in Candlelight;
  • Apply Too Faced Shadow Bon Bons eyshadows as follows:
    • Vanilla under the eyebrow and near the bridge of the nose;
    • Nude Beach in the inner 1/3 of the eyelid and extend out along the lash line to half way across the eyelid;
    • Cinnamon Sugar in the middle 1/2 of the eyelid and up to the crease;
    • Lovey Dovey on the outer 1/3 of the eyelid and up into the crease, creating a cut crease look;
    •  Licorice Latte to the outer V of the eye area and extend out, blending into the crease for a winged out look;
    • Blend for seamless transition from one colour to the next.
  • Apply Urban Decay eyeliner in Zero to the upper and lower lash lines;
  • Apply Too Faced Lashgasm mascara.
